Petaluma Police are reminding the public of road closures tomorrow in the downtown area for the annual Cruisin the Boulevard Car Show. Celebrating the 50th anniversary of the film American Graffiti, the event is scheduled to start at 10 AM and end at about 8 PM (10 hours). Road closures will take effect starting at 5 AM and will be lifted at 8 PM.
Road closures will include the following:
Water St, American Alley, Telephone Alley, and the A St Parking Lot
Petaluma Blvd North (between D St and Washington St)
The #2 eastbound lane of Washington St (between Keller St and Petaluma Blvd N) Western Avenue (between Petaluma Blvd N and Keller St)
4th St / Kentucky St (between B St and Washington St)
B St (between 2nd St and 4th St)

Eastbound and Westbound traffic on D Street will be condensed to one lane in each direction starting at 4 PM for the actual cruise portion of the event. Westbound traffic on D St will not be allowed from Northbound Petaluma Blvd S during this time as well.
The Police Department will be working this event to reasonably accommodate any traffic related issues. The Petaluma Police Department appreciates the public’s patience and understanding, and requests those who cannot avoid the area to allow plenty of time for travel.
